The Basis of Mesothelioma Litigation
The foundation of a lot of [Mesothelioma Compensation](https://hedgedoc.info.uqam.ca/s/kIgYvAFPn) suits lies in the principle of liability. For years, makers of asbestos-containing products knew the health risks associated with breathing in tiny asbestos fibers. Regardless of this understanding, many business continued to produce and disperse these items without supplying adequate safety cautions or protective devices to workers.

When a person establishes mesothelioma cancer years later on, they may submit a lawsuit versus the entities accountable for their exposure. These cases usually fall into two classifications:
Personal Injury Claims: Filed by the individual detected with mesothelioma. These claims look for to recuperate damages sustained during the patient's lifetime.Wrongful Death Claims: Filed by the making it through member of the family after an enjoyed one has passed away from the disease. These actions look for to compensate the family for funeral expenditures, loss of consortium, and the income the deceased would have offered.Kinds Of Compensation Available

Browsing a legal case is an intricate procedure that needs specific proficiency. While every case is unique, most follow a structured timeline:
1. Preliminary Consultation and Case Evaluation
The process begins with an interview where a legal group collects information regarding the person's medical history and work history. Since mesothelioma cancer has a long latency period (20 to 50 years), determining the exact source of exposure needs meticulous investigation.
2. Submitting the Claim
When the legal group recognizes the accountable celebrations (defendants), an official grievance is submitted in the proper court. This file details the accusations against the companies and the damages being looked for.
3. The Discovery Phase
In this phase, both sides exchange details. The plaintiff's lawyers will gather evidence such as:
Employment records and union logs.Medical records and pathology reports.In-depth testimony (depositions) relating to the products used.Expert witness testimonies from medical professionals and industrial hygienists.4. Settlement Negotiations
The vast bulk of mesothelioma cancer cases are settled out of court. Defendants frequently choose to settle to avoid the unpredictability of a jury trial and the high expenses of extended lawsuits.
5. Trial and Verdict
If a settlement can not be reached, the case continues to trial. A judge or jury hears the evidence and figures out if the defendants are responsible. If they find in favor of the complainant, they will award a specific quantity in damages.
Showing Exposure and Liability
To win a mesothelioma cancer legal case, the complainant should satisfy several evidentiary requirements. Success depends upon showing that the defendant's product was the "near cause" of the illness.

Crucial element needed for a successful claim include:
Proof of Diagnosis: Official medical records confirming a mesothelioma cancer diagnosis.Evidence of Exposure: Documentation showing that the complainant worked with or around particular asbestos-containing products.Link to Negligence: Demonstrating that the business understood or should have learnt about the dangers and failed to act.Statute of Limitations: Ensuring the claim is filed within the legal timeframe allowed by the state.The Importance of Statutes of Limitations
One of the most critical aspects of a mesothelioma case is the statute of limitations. This is a law that sets a stringent deadline for submitting a lawsuit. If a victim or their household misses this window, they lose their right to seek payment forever.

The rules for these due dates can be complex since they differ considerably by state. In mesothelioma cases, the "clock" typically starts to tick at the time of diagnosis (for injury) or at the time of death (for wrongful death), instead of at the time of exposure.
Table 2: Comparative Look at Statutes of Limitations (Examples)StatePersonal Injury DeadlineWrongful Death DeadlineCalifornia1 year from diagnosis1 year from deathNew York3 years from diagnosis2 years from deathTexas2 years from medical diagnosis2 years from deathFlorida4 years from diagnosis2 years from death
Keep in mind: These are general examples. Legal counsel needs to always be sought advice from to figure out particular due dates.

Anyone detected with mesothelioma cancer who can link their health problem to asbestos exposure is eligible. If the victim has died, their estate or instant family members (spouse, kids, or brother or sisters) might be qualified to file a wrongful death claim.
How long does a mesothelioma cancer case take?
While some cases can take a year or more, many mesothelioma cancer lawyers strive to speed up the process due to the health of the complainant. Settlements can sometimes be reached within a few months, whereas cases going to trial take longer.
What if the company responsible for my direct exposure runs out company?
Many business that produced asbestos items have actually declared insolvency. As part of their reorganization, they were needed to establish asbestos trust funds. There is currently over ₤ 30 billion offered in these funds to compensate future victims, even if the business no longer exists in its initial form.
Will I need to go to court?
It is unlikely. Most mesothelioma cancer cases are fixed through settlements or trust fund declares without the plaintiff ever needing to step foot in a courtroom. If a trial is essential, lawyers typically set up for depositions to be taken at the complainant's home to accommodate their health.
Can I file a claim if I was exposed to asbestos in the military?
Yes. Numerous veterans were exposed to asbestos in shipyards, barracks, and on marine vessels. Veterans may be qualified for both VA advantages and the right to sue the private business that produced the asbestos items used by the military. Note that the lawsuit is submitted versus the makers, not the U.S. federal government.
